Coalition awards Selky for contribution to Niger Delta development

By Adeola Tukuru

Abuja

The Coalition of Niger Delta Intellectuals from Diaspora (CNDID), has awarded to Chief Selky Mile Torughedi, also known as Gen. Young Shall Grow in recognition of his commitment in the struggle for the development of the Niger Delta Region and the people
The non-governmental organisation of Niger Students who studied in various universities abroad presented the award dinner in Abuja, expressed their gratitude to the role played by the agitation of Torughedi and his fellow compatriots for the economic and political advancement and development of the Niger Delta Region.
The group in a statement made available yesterday maintained that Torughedi also known as Gen. Young Shall Grow struggles brought about the rise in the human resources development of the Niger Delta People and the region
They maintained that this brought about education, acquisition of skills and infrastructural development through the Niger Delta Development Commission (NDDC), the Niger Delta Ministry and the Presidential Amnesty Programme
Speaking at the dinner, the group expressed great appreciation for his efforts and roles played to attract federal intervention in order to address and assuage the problems of the region and its people.
They further stressed the need for unity amongst all the compatriots stressing that it is necessary for peace in the region and also among all the sister tribes in the region as there can never be any meaningful development without peace in the region.
They noted that the region coulf grind to a halt in terms of agricultural, economic, commercial, Infrastructural and social activities without peace and unity.
Torughedi in an appreciation of the award urged the group to avoid political entanglements but rather focus on their intellectual prowess and to deploy same as think-tanks in order to proffer solutions to the myriad of proplems facing the region.
He urged them to create programs that would fosters industriousness that will engage people in the region
The group further urged him no to relent in the good work of philanthropism and the defense of the economic, educational, infrastructural as well as the political rights of the Niger Delta People and to work consistently with his fellow compatriots continually to move the region forward stressing the need to mend fences with other compatriots so that they can foster an unbreakable cooperation for the good of the people and the region.
